  • Life at Intel: https://jobs.intel.com/en/life-at-intel As an LTD Product Development Engineer, you will play a pivotal role in advancing our technology.
  • This position involves developing and validating (with design and on silicon) test programs used to improve key technology yield, performance and reliability metrics.
  • The group supports wafer Sort, unit Class test, Burn In and Parametric Testing.
  • It involves working closely with TD and Foundry Program, Yield, Design, Device and Quality/Reliability customers.

  • Your responsibilities as a Product Development Engineer will include but not be limited to: Defining test plans and roadmaps with key customers consistent with tool capabilities and resources.
  • Developing test content for parametric (ETest), cache (array), or Analog Mixed Signal (AMS) test programs.
  • Coordinating and validating the results for new products through Test operations.
  • Documenting and validating changes to existing test programs.
  • Modifying test conditions for engineering requests and summarizing the results.
  • Collaborating with Tester Module engineers to improve operations and tool performance.
  • Debug of unexpected test results.
